First off, the concept of a smart mirror is pretty amazing. Imagine having a regular mirror that can also display weather updates, your calendar, or even play music! It’s the perfect blend of functionality and aesthetics. I decided to go with a Raspberry Pi as the brain behind the mirror since it’s compact, affordable, and has a large community for support.
One of the biggest challenges I faced was ensuring the mirror didn’t have any glare or reflection issues, especially when displaying content. I did some research and found that using a privacy glass film on the mirror really helped with reducing reflections. It was a bit tricky to apply, but the result was worth it!
Another thing I wanted to mention is the importance of proper wiring and mounting. I opted for a wireless setup to keep things clean, but I still had to manage the power supply and the Raspberry Pi’s components. I recommend investing in some high-quality adhesive mounts and maybe even consulting a professional if you’re not entirely confident about the electrical aspects.
I also found that using a touch overlay was a game-changer. It allowed me to interact with the mirror without any issues, and it gave the whole setup a sleek, finished look. I sourced mine from a local electronics store, but there are plenty of options available online.
For those of you who are tech-savvy, I’d suggest exploring the different software options available. There are some fantastic open-source projects that you can customize to suit your needs. I ended up using a combination of Python scripts and a custom-built interface that I found on GitHub. It was a bit of a learning curve, but it gave me the flexibility to tweak everything exactly how I wanted it.
One thing I’d caution against is trying to do too much too soon. Start with the basics—like displaying the time and weather—and gradually add more features as you become more comfortable. This approach not only makes the project more manageable but also allows you to troubleshoot and refine each component as you go.
